Steps to reproduce this bug:
1. Wait until there is no game music currently playing.
2. Click on a leader to open a leader screen.
3. Conduct trade or do whatever you like, but wait several minutes until the game music resets.
4. Both the leader music and game music overlap to produce a very annoying cacophony of sound.
(This bug only occurs when there isn't already game music playing when you open a leader screen.)
I was surprised when I googled this that I couldn't find any other reports of this bug. This has been going on since the first release of Civ IV, although this never happened in Civ III. In Civ III, the game music would remain paused until you leave the leader screen, after which it would resume. Why can't the same be done for Civ IV?
